Skill: plan
Create structured plans for complex tasks and projects.
When to Use
- New projects or features
- Complex refactoring
- Multi-file changes
- When unsure of approach
- Before writing significant code
Planning Process
1. Understand the Goal
- What is the desired end state?
- What problem does this solve?
- What are the constraints?
2. Analyze Current State
- What exists today?
- What needs to change?
- What are the dependencies?
3. Identify Paths Forward
- Option A: {description}
- Option B: {description}
- Option C: {description}
4. Evaluate Options
- Pros and cons of each
- Risk assessment
- Effort vs. value
5. Choose Direction
- Select best path
- Document rationale
- Define success criteria
6. Decompose into Steps
- Atomic, verifiable tasks
- Dependencies identified
- Estimated effort

Planning Modes
Quick Plan
- 5-10 minutes
- High-level only
- Good for small tasks
Full Plan
- 20-30 minutes
- Detailed steps
- Risk analysis
- Good for complex work
